Comprehending the Modern Running Machine


A running maker, commonly described as a treadmill in the UK, is an electrical or manual gadget developed to simulate the experience of running or strolling while staying in one place. The essential mechanism involves a conveyor belt that moves across a deck or platform, permitting the user to stroll or run in place while the belt moves backwards below their feet. This apparently basic concept has actually evolved considerably since the early mechanical designs, with contemporary running makers featuring sophisticated electronic devices, programmable exercises, slope abilities, and advanced cushioning systems designed to minimize influence on joints.

Important Features to Consider When Purchasing


Before selecting a running machine, potential buyers ought to examine several critical features that figure out viability for their particular requirements and situations. view products stands as possibly the most crucial technical spec, usually measured in continuous horse power or CHP. Running makers meant for walking need less effective motors than those developed for running, with many quality home devices using motors in between 2.0 and 4.0 CHP. Those preparation routine jogging or running sessions ought to focus on machines with motors at the 2.5 CHP minimum, while severe runners might wish to consider 3.0 CHP or more powerful options that can handle continual usage without overheating or efficiency destruction.

Running surface area measurements substantially affect comfort and security, particularly for taller people or those with longer stride lengths. A running deck needs to offer at least 120 centimetres in length and 45 centimetres in width for comfy running, with premium models offering 150 centimetres by 50 centimetres or more. Users should consider their height and stride when examining these requirements, as devices with insufficient area can feel cramped and boost fall danger, especially at faster speeds or when fatigue embeds in throughout longer workouts.

Incline capability has ended up being a basic feature throughout a lot of running makers in the UK market, permitting users to replicate uphill running and boost workout intensity without increasing speed. Manual slope systems require users to physically change the deck angle between workouts, while automatic slope systems can be programmed to alter throughout workouts. The optimum incline varies between models, normally varying from 10 to 15 percent, with some premium makers providing decline capability too for downhill training simulation.

Rate Categories and What to Expect


Running makers cover a broad rate spectrum in the UK, with distinct categories providing various function sets, develop qualities, and designated user populations. Understanding these categories prevents buyers from spending beyond your means on features they do not require or acquiring underpowered equipment that stops working to satisfy their requirements.

Spending plan makers priced between ₤ 400 and ₤ 800 generally feature fundamental motor abilities, easier electronic screens, and more limited workout programs. These systems fit periodic walkers, those brand-new to exercise, or homes where the machine will see light usage just. Develop quality in this range typically shows the cost point, with lighter building and construction and less premium parts.

Mid-range machines between ₤ 800 and ₤ 1,800 represent the sweet area for most home users. This classification usually provides trusted motors appropriate for routine running, adequate deck cushioning, numerous workout programs, and affordable construct quality that will endure numerous years of routine usage. Many customers find their needs well-met within this cost bracket.

Premium makers priced above ₤ 1,800 provide commercial-grade building and construction, effective motors capable of continual heavy usage, advanced cushioning systems, big touchscreens with interactive training platforms, and thorough service warranties that may extend for decades. Severe runners, those training for competitive occasions, or households with several regular users often gravitate towards this category for the toughness and efficiency benefits.

Practical Considerations Before Buying


Beyond specs and price, useful factors considerably influence running maker complete satisfaction. Available area is worthy of cautious factor to consider, as running machines occupy substantial flooring location both throughout use and when stored. Many designs include folding designs that minimize storage footprint by approximately 50 percent, though folded measurements ought to be validated versus offered storage area. Users need to likewise think about the ceiling height in their selected place to make sure adequate clearance throughout use, especially when running at rate with natural vertical movement.

Weight and delivery plans matter more than many purchasers at first realize. Running devices normally weigh between 80 and 150 kgs, with delivery to upper floors or remote locations possibly sustaining significant added fees. Some merchants use premium shipment services including assembly and old equipment elimination, which can prove rewarding for those lacking technical self-confidence or physical support.

Warranty terms differ significantly in between makers and cost points. Quality running devices normally use frame warranties of 10 years to lifetime, motor service warranties of 5 to 12 years, and parts and labour coverage of 1 to 3 years. Understanding these terms before purchase assists customers evaluate real long-term value, as a more affordable maker with restricted warranty protection may show more costly with time if elements stop working after protection expires.

Keeping Your Running Machine


Proper upkeep extends the life-span of any running machine and makes sure consistent performance throughout its working life. Routine upkeep jobs fall into several categories, with cleaning representing the most frequent requirement. Dust, sweat, and particles collect on and around the running belt, deck, and electronics, potentially impacting functionality and hygiene. Wiping down hand rails, console surface areas, and exposed frame components after each use avoids accumulation that can degrade materials in time.

The running belt requires regular change as it extends with use. The majority of makers include mechanisms for stress adjustment, which should be checked every couple of months according to producer standards. Properly tensioned belts ought to not slip throughout use however ought to not be so tight that they worry motor bearings. Lubrication schedules differ by model, with some needing belt lubrication every few months and others featuring maintenance-free decks that never ever require extra lubrication.

Electrical and mechanical elements benefit from routine evaluation, especially in machines subjected to heavy use or those situated in garages or other challenging environments. Checking power cords for damage, ensuring correct belt alignment, and listening for unusual sounds during operation helps determine developing issues before they result in failure or security risks.

Regularly Asked Questions About Running Machines


What is the minimum motor size needed for working on a treadmill?

For routine running instead of simply strolling, a continuous horsepower score of at least 2.5 CHP is suggested for many users. Those over 100 kgs in body weight or preparation extreme training programs must consider 3.0 CHP or more powerful motors that can deal with continual load without overheating. Budget plan machines with motors listed below 2.0 CHP might struggle with running speeds over 10 kilometres per hour and can overheat during longer sessions.

How much area does a running maker need?

In usage, most running makers need a clear location of around 180 to 220 centimetres in length and 80 to 100 centimetres in width. Folded measurements differ considerably, with some compact models reducing to around 100 centimetres by 80 centimetres when saved upright. Users must likewise account for clearance at the front and back of the maker and guarantee adequate ceiling height for comfy running.

Are running machines loud enough to disturb neighbours?

Modern quality running devices produce sound levels in between 60 and 75 decibels during operation, equivalent to a vacuum cleaner or typical discussion. The primary noise sources consist of the motor, beltDeck interaction, and effect of feet on the running surface. Running machines developed for home use generally include sound reduction features, and positioning devices on proper flooring or rubber mats further minimizes sound transmission to adjoining properties.

Can running machines aid with weight loss?

Running makers supply efficient cardiovascular exercise that adds to calorie expenditure and can support weight loss when integrated with suitable dietary management. A 70-kilogram person can anticipate to burn approximately 500 to 800 calories per hour of energetic treadmill running, depending on speed, incline, and private metabolism. The benefit of home devices often increases exercise frequency compared to needing health club check outs, possibly supporting higher overall calorie expenditure in time.
